Arturo proudly served in the US Army for over 30 years; including 4 tours in Vietnam. He was a true Patriot who loved his country dearly. Arturo was a cook in the military as well as, a cook at Luby's for many years. Also, he previously worked at Gulf Marine drilling. Arturo enjoyed music, cards, dominos, watching his favorite shows on TV, and the Dallas Cowboys. He loved his wife and daughter with all his heart; but his greatest pastime was spending time with his grandsons. He was truly a family man that never hesitated to help anyone that needed him.
He was preceded in death by his mother, Isidra P. Martinez.
